About three weeks ago, I had the opportunity to go to the far away kingdom of Traverse City for a weekend away with my friends and go skiing/snowboarding. Sounds fun, right? Nothing could go wrong, right? WRONG!

Just a little back story, for those of you who are unaware, I am not a graceful person. I can trip over my own feet like it’s nobody’s business. So, me learning to snowboard probably was not the best idea in the world to begin with.

Regardless of my lack of sporting abilities, I held my head high on the ski lift, awaiting my turn to fly down the beautiful snowy mountain with poise, elegance, and complete confidence in myself. Before I even get fully off the ski lift, SPLAT! Fell right on my face.

Over the course of the next two hours, I only was able to make it down the mountain three times… THREE TIMES! Not because I was trying to go slow, but I kept going too fast and wiping out. My last time down the mountain, all I kept thinking about was, “This is my last time snowboarding down this mountain today… I will rent skis.” Mid-thought I hit a snow drift and flew forward knocking myself out. I couldn’t breathe for about a good 30 seconds to a minute!

I eventually learned that I am better on skis, once I got up the courage to go down the mountain again. I felt like I was flying down the mountain as I would follow the turns and curves that lay ahead of me. I finally felt unstoppable, and I am pleased to announce did not fall on skis once.


I knew going into this experience that I would feel a whole new level of sore the next day. What I didn’t anticipate was having a badly bruised rib that would take 4-6 weeks to heal! So unfortunately, I have not been able to run for the last three weeks; however, over the past few days I have been feeling much better and am looking forward to getting the opportunity to get back on that treadmill!
